Q: Is 663,760 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 663,760 is a composite number.

Why is 663,760 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 663,760 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 5 8 10 16 20 40 80 8,297 16,594 33,188 41,485 66,376 82,970 132,752 165,940 331,880 and 663,760, with no remainder.

Since 663,760 cannot be divided by just 1 and 663,760, it is a composite number.
